ClickCease 오픈 소스 보안에서 커뮤니티의 역할

목차

인기 뉴스레터 구독하기

4,500명 이상의 Linux 및 오픈 소스 전문가와 함께하세요!

한 달에 두 번. 스팸이 없습니다.

오픈 소스 보안에서 커뮤니티의 역할: 협업을 통해 보호를 강화하는 방법

by 레오 코라도

2025년 3월 25일 게스트 작가

모든 사용자가 자신의 필요에 맞게 소스 코드를 수정할 수 있는 소프트웨어를 의미하는 오픈 소스 소프트웨어(OSS)는 현대 사회에서 협업과 혁신의 대표적인 예입니다.

투명하고 커뮤니티 중심적인 성격의 전 세계 개발자와 사용자는 서로가 소프트웨어에서 필요한 것을 얻을 수 있도록 코드를 기여하고, 검사하고, 개선합니다.

하지만 이러한 협업 환경은 혁신을 가속화할 뿐만 아니라 오픈 소스 보안에도 중요한 역할을 합니다.

이 글에서는 모든 사용자가 이러한 프로그램을 안전하게 사용할 수 있도록 하기 위해 OSS 커뮤니티의 집단적 경계가 필수적인 이유와 오픈소스 보안이 공동의 책임에 달려 있는 이유에 대해 설명합니다. 오픈 소스 보안의 강점과 과제를 이해함으로써 소프트웨어를 안전하게 유지하는 데 있어 커뮤니티가 얼마나 중요한 역할을 하는지 알 수 있습니다.

집단적 경계의 힘

 

라이너스의 법칙에 따르면 "눈만 충분하면 모든 버그는 얕다"고 합니다.

오픈 소스 보안 업계의 이 격언은 오픈 소스 프로그램의 보안을 유지하는 데 커뮤니티 협업이 중요한 이유를 잘 설명해 줍니다. 수많은 개발자가 프로그램과 코드를 사용하고, 검토하고, 수정하기 때문에 버그와 취약점이 발견될 가능성이 더 높습니다. 

사용자는 발견한 버그와 취약점은 물론 해결 방법을 기꺼이 공유해야 합니다. 개발자도 스스로 해결책을 찾을 수 없는 경우 다른 개발자의 도움을 받는 경우가 많습니다. 이를 통해 프로그램의 보안과 기능을 모두 개선하는 패치가 신속하고 일관되게 제공될 수 있습니다.

그렇기 때문에 가장 안전하고 우수한 오픈소스 소프트웨어는 커뮤니티의 힘과 열의에 의해 정의되는 경우가 많습니다. 이러한 추가적인 보안 계층 때문에 기업에서도 오픈 소스 소프트웨어를 찾는 이유입니다..

보안을 강화하는 협업 프레임워크

 

커뮤니티의 노력이 OSS 정신의 핵심 축인 만큼, 오픈소스 커뮤니티 전반에서는 실제로 보안을 개선하기 위한 다양한 노력을 조정하기 위해 다양한 프레임워크를 구축했습니다. 

예를 들어, 오픈소스 보안 재단(OpenSSF)은 "공익을 위해 오픈소스 소프트웨어를 보호하기 위해 함께 노력하는 소프트웨어 개발자, 보안 엔지니어 등으로 구성된 커뮤니티"라고 설명합니다.

오픈소스 보안을 개선하기 위한 노력을 통합하기 위해 오픈소스 보안을 개선하기 위한 노력을 통합하기 위해 OpenSSF는 다양한 분야의 전문가들을 한자리에 모았습니다. 이를 통해 인식을 확산하고 대화를 촉진하며 지식의 교환과 더 많은 협업을 장려합니다.

정부 및 업계 지원

 

전 세계 정부 기관에서도 오픈 소스 보안이 다양한 산업에서 점점 더 중요한 역할을 하고 있음을 인식하고 있습니다. 

예를 들어, 사이버 보안 및 인프라 보안 기관(CISA)은 오픈 소스 소프트웨어 개발자의 보안 문제를 돕기 위한 이니셔티브를 제공합니다.

오픈소스 보안 강화를 위한 모범 사례

 

물론 오픈소스 보안을 위해서는 커뮤니티의 노력이 가장 중요하지만, 개인의 노력도 무시할 수 없습니다. 결국, 보안은 항상 나 자신으로부터 시작됩니다!

개발자는 항상 OSS 개발 및 유지 관리와 관련된 모범 사례를 준수해야 합니다.. 여기에는 다음이 포함됩니다:

  • 정기적이고 철저한 코드 감사

정기적인 감사를 수행하면 개발자는 사용자가 오류, 버그, 취약점을 발견하고 이로 인해 피해를 입기 전에 이를 발견할 수 있습니다.

  • 종속성 관리 

오픈 소스 소프트웨어는 다른 소프트웨어의 모듈에 의존하는 경우가 많으므로 종속성을 항상 유지 관리해야 합니다. 가져온 모든 라이브러리를 항상 업데이트하여 OSS에 최신 패치와 수정 사항이 적용되도록 하세요.

  • 내부에서 모범 사례 수립

코딩 시 적절한 오류 처리부터 가상 사설망 통신 채널의 보안을 위해 팀원 모두가 최고의 사이버 보안 관행을 완전히 숙지하고 있어야 합니다.

도전 과제와 앞으로 나아갈 길

 

오픈 소스 소프트웨어는 탈중앙화되고 민주화되어 있다는 점이 강점입니다. 그러나 코드 품질과 보안 관행의 불일치로 인해 이러한 프로그램이 취약해질 수 있다는 약점도 있습니다. 

그렇기 때문에 오픈소스 보안은 개발자와 사용자 모두가 공유하는 우선 순위가 되어야 합니다.

그렇기 때문에 오픈 소스 보안 커뮤니티의 구성원들이 서로를 지지하는 것이 더욱 중요합니다. 

이러한 프로그램의 안전과 기능을 유지하기 위한 경계와 열의를 통해서만 온라인 커뮤니티는 오픈 소스 소프트웨어의 이점을 누릴 수 있습니다. 강력한 오픈소스 보안 관행은 안전성을 훼손하지 않으면서 혁신을 지속할 수 있도록 보장합니다.

오픈 소스 보안 세계에서는 진정으로 투명하고 커뮤니티가 주도하는 협업이 더욱 중요해지고 있습니다. 보안뿐만 아니라 다른 여러 가지 이유도 있지만, 결국 사용량이 증가하고 있습니다, 오픈 소스 보안에 대한 사람들의 신뢰는 감소하고 있습니다..

적극적인 참여와 감독을 통해 오픈소스 보안을 강화함으로써 오픈 소스 보안을 강화함으로써 개발자와 사용자는 오픈 소스 소프트웨어에 대한 신뢰를 회복할 수 있습니다.

따라서 오픈소스 소프트웨어의 모든 개발자와 사용자는 OSS가 안전하고 민주화된 상태로 유지되도록 각자의 역할을 다해야 합니다.

요약
오픈 소스 보안에서 커뮤니티의 역할: 협업을 통해 보호를 강화하는 방법
기사 이름
오픈 소스 보안에서 커뮤니티의 역할: 협업을 통해 보호를 강화하는 방법
설명
오픈소스 프로그램의 배후에 있는 커뮤니티는 오픈소스 보안에 중요한 역할을 하며, 이러한 프로그램이 안전하고 신뢰할 수 있도록 보장합니다.
작성자
게시자 이름
TuxCare
게시자 로고

Kernel 재부팅, 시스템 다운타임 또는 예정된 유지 보수 기간 없이 취약성 패치를 자동화하고 싶으신가요?